routstr v0.2.2 - fixfix

v0.2.2 - release summary
--------------------------
#292 - Fix not enough inputs to melt
#295 - Update UI dependencies
#291 - Fix reserved balance
#289 - Better filtering options (#282)
#284 - Do not charge for empty content (#274)
#298 - Fix Provider Balance display in dashboard
#299 - fix refunds not accounting reserved balance
#300 - reset reserved balance on startup (optional)
#303 - ignore disabled provider
#301 - optimize price fetching
